The Coventry Rugby team has just been announced that is back home at the Butts Park Arena as they face Plymouth Albion with kick off at 3pm. next Saturday 3rd October.
The team shows 8 changes including 1 positional change from the starting line-up that lost to Richmond last Saturday, Centre Callum MacBurnie goes onto the bench and injured Rob Knox are replaced by James Tincknell back after injury and a first league start for Sam Smith. On the wing Peter Weightman replaces Sam Baker.
In the front row Devlin Hope starts as hooker in place of Matt Price who goes onto the bench and there is recall for Adam Parkins after illness in place of Chad Thorne. At lock there is another first start for Ben Thomas in place of Courtney Roberts, The back row sees a recall for George Oliver in place of Alex Woodburn, who switches to No 6 in place of Danny Wright. There is one further change on the bench with the first season’s appearance of Jacques Le Roux in place of Loti Molitika.
